Rowling Takes on Amnesty UK

JK Rowling has threatened to sue Amnesty UK after it labeled Beira's Place, a sexual violence support charity she funds, as 'anti-rights' and 'gender critical'. The report was withdrawn and Amnesty International distanced itself from it.

Scotland's Record on Women

Scotland has a poor recent record in protecting women, including placing a convicted rapist, Adam Graham, in a women's prison after he identified as Isla Bryson. He was removed after an outcry. Mridul Wadhwa, a transwoman, was put in charge of Edinburgh Rape Crisis but stepped down after failing to provide women-only spaces for 16 months.
